Originally Posted by Highside Ho do you figure that you are getting close to 14:1? According to CP the stock setup only specs out at around 10.7 despite what honda claims. You can safely take off .020 on the stocker but that doesnt get there. The cp 13:1 piston puts the valves at .050 from the piston. How close are you running it? More displacement maybe? |
That too. Alot of guys just deck the head and throw in a Hi comp piston and call it good.
I mill the head, deck the cylinder, modify the chamber, sink the valves but also unshroud them, modify the piston to match the head mods, I could on and on.
